Ferris State Athletes Reach Three D2 National Provisional Qualifying Marks At Hillsdale Last Chance Event

Big Rapids, Mich. - A selected number of Ferris State University men's and women's track and field throwers competed on Thursday (May 13) at the Hillsdale Last Chance Classic in Hillsdale.

The competition at Hillsdale's Ken Herrick Track served as an opportunity for athletes to compete an additional time in an effort to improve upon their performances in hopes of reaching NCAA Division II National qualifying marks. 

Along with Ferris State, the event featured athletes in different events from schools across the region from all levels of competition.

FSU's Brianna Copley placed fourth in the discus (154-0) along with fifth in the shot put (45-3.75) while reaching NCAA Division II National Provisional qualification marks in both events.

Meanwhile, Emma Stephayn came in sixth overall in the hammer throw (162-00) with Kennedy Riebschleger placing sixth in the javelin (97-0). Riebschleger also was 12th overall in the hammer (136-7).

On the men's side, the Bulldogs' Brett Robertson was the runner-up in the 400-meter hurdles (53.09) and reached the D2 national provisional qualifying standard. 

Additionally, FSU's Trevor Roznowski placed 11th in the discus (146-5) along with 13th in the hammer throw (167-10).

The official selections for the NCAA Division II National Championships will be announced next Tuesday (May 18) by the national committee.
